问题: Do you think ideas from books or writers in the past are all outdated?
思路 1
No
考官答案
No, I don't think all ideas from past writers are outdated. Many classic books still have a lot to offer. For example, the works of Shakespeare or Jane Austen give us insights into human emotions and social interactions that are still very much applicable today. These books help us understand different aspects of human nature and societal structures, which haven't really changed all that much over the centuries.

Yes, I think some ideas from books in the past might be considered outdated today. For instance, the views on race, gender, or science presented in some older works do not align with modern understandings and values. Society has evolved, and with it, our perspectives on many issues have changed. This can make some of the ideas expressed in older literature seem irrelevant or incorrect by today's standards.

It really depends on the type of ideas and the context in which they were written. Some scientific theories from the past have been disproven and replaced by more accurate models. However, themes in literature that explore human emotions and experiences can still be very relevant. Readers today might find new meanings or interpretations in old texts based on current societal contexts.
